I know people are curious sometimes about who the people are behind the anonymous-looking website. Impression Obsession was formed in March 1998 by Mitra Friant and Charmaine Jackson, two high school teachers who thought it would be fun to run a stamp business part-time after school. We published our first stamp catalog with 92 images in August, 1998 and we were off and running.

We had a lot of success with that first catalog and continued adding images (and customers) until the company became too busy to be a part-time job. In September, 1999, I (Mitra) quit teaching and started working at the stamp business full-time. Charmaine, meanwhile, had a baby and decided to continue teaching so she got out of the stamp business.

2015 marks 17 years in business…I can’t believe it! IO has come a long way since then. We now have 10,000 images in production at any given time and have expanded into offering clear stamps, cling stamps (stamps with gray cushion that temporarily stick to acrylic blocks), and metal dies. We are proud to offer designs from Dina Kowal, Seth Apter, Lindsay Ostrom, Yvonne Blair, Alesa Baker Designs, Heart Art Studios, Melissa Gordon, Leigh Hannan, Gary Robertson, Gail Green, Claudia Tenorio-Pearl, Kalani Allred, Hannah Davies, Tara Caldwell, Aislinn Adams, Julie Fei-Fan Balzer, and Joanne Fink. With so many different artists, we offer stamps in a wide range of styles. There is truly something for everyone at Impression Obsession.

I am helped (greatly) by 8 full-time and one part-time employees who work in our warehouse pressing rubber, trimming stamps, indexing wood, and packing orders. I truly can’t remember what it was like when Charmaine and I made all of the stamps ourselves (I think I’ve blacked the memory out). I’m lucky to have a great staff who has stuck with me (several of them for years and years) through all the ups and downs that come with running a small business.

It’s been a great ride so far and we’re still going strong. 2016 will bring lots of new products, new designs, and new techniques. Happy stamping!
